What Is a Bi-Colour Sapphire?
A bi-colour sapphire is one continuous corundum crystal that carries two distinct colours in different zones of the same stone. The colours are the crystal's own — nothing is layered, coated, or joined. In the trade, bi-colour sapphires are also called parti-coloured sapphires or, when the zoning is visible enough to define the stone, simply colour-zoned sapphires. What separates a bi-colour from a stone with mild zoning is the sharpness of the boundary and the vividness of both colours face-up.
How Bi-Colour Sapphires Form
Corundum takes its colour from trace elements: iron and titanium together give blue; iron alone gives yellow; chromium gives pink or red. Bi-colour zoning happens when the chemistry of the mineralising fluid changes during growth. The trace elements that were feeding the crystal shift — a burst of titanium creates a blue band; a stretch without it and with more iron creates yellow; a moment of chromium creates pink. Because the crystal keeps growing throughout, the result is one seamless stone with abrupt colour transitions rather than a joined composite.
Ceylon Bi-Colour Sapphires
Sri Lanka's Ratnapura and Elahera fields produce a large share of the world's marketable bi-colour sapphires. Ceylon bi-colours are prized for three reasons: the individual zones are usually bright and clean rather than muddy; the boundaries between colours tend to be sharp; and blue-yellow combinations — the most commercially recognised — occur here more often than in almost any other origin. Fine Ceylon bi-colours have been recorded historically at all the major auction houses, though the market for them is smaller and more specialist than the market for single-colour sapphires.
Cutting a Bi-Colour Sapphire
Cutting is where a bi-colour sapphire becomes either a design piece or a curiosity. The cutter first studies the rough to map where the colours sit. Then they make a design decision:
- Split the stone. Orient the rough so the boundary runs straight across the face-up view — the stone reads as two equal halves. Emerald and cushion cuts suit this best.
- Anchor one colour. Make one colour the dominant field and let the second show as a stripe, corner, or crescent. Rings often use this treatment.
- Read both from the face. Orient the rough so both colours are visible from directly above, even if the boundary is diagonal. Requires a shallower cut and more waste.
A well-cut bi-colour presents both colours cleanly from the face. A poorly cut one either loses one of the colours to the pavilion or lets the boundary appear only from the side. Because the rough is naturally rare, cutting waste on bi-colours is high — expect a lower yield than a same-weight single-colour rough.
Treatments & Certification
Bi-colour sapphires are almost always sold unheated. Heat treatment is the standard enhancement for single-colour sapphires, but on a bi-colour it tends to blur the boundary between the two zones or wash one of them out. A well-preserved bi-colour with sharp zoning is therefore, in most cases, a natural stone that has not seen the furnace — but the only way to be certain is an independent laboratory report.
Any bi-colour sapphire sold as unheated should carry a report from GIA, GRS, Gübelin, or SSEF confirming “no indications of heating”. For high-value stones a mention of the specific colour zones and their sharpness in the report's comments section adds substantial resale value. Buying Considerations
- Colour vividness. Both zones should be saturated and read as themselves. A pale yellow next to a pale blue reads as a grey stone; a vivid yellow next to a vivid blue reads as a bi-colour.
- Boundary sharpness. The transition from one colour to the other should be a clean line, not a slow fade. Sharp boundaries are the mark of natural, untreated bi-colours.
- Face-up presentation. Both colours should be visible from directly above. If one only appears from the side, cutting has failed the stone.
- Zone proportions. Even splits are the most recognised in the market, but stones with a dominant colour and a smaller accent zone can be more design-forward and often cost less per carat.
- Origin. Ceylon bi-colours tend to have brighter individual zones and cleaner boundaries than most other origins.
- Certification. Insist on an unheated determination from a leading laboratory. It is the single most important factor in resale value.

Which colour combinations occur in bi-colour sapphires?+
The most common combinations are (1) blue and yellow — the classic Ceylon bi-colour, often with a sharp boundary between the two zones; (2) blue and green — a subtle transition through the teal range; (3) pink and orange — the rarest and most valuable, sometimes graded as bi-colour padparadscha; (4) yellow and green; and (5) blue, yellow and clear together (tri-colour). Vivid, well-separated zones with clear boundaries are most valued.

How rare are bi-colour sapphires?+
Bi-colour sapphires are considerably rarer than single-colour sapphires — most rough corundum forms with a single colour or with zoning too subtle to be noticed. Only a small fraction of mined rough has clearly defined, marketable bi-colour zoning, and an even smaller fraction survives cutting with the zones intact. Well-cut, vivid bi-colours above 3 carats are collector-grade stones.
